(adsbygoogle = window.adsbygoogle || []).push({}); I was wondering if someone would be interested in telling me what buttons stick for the infections in an infection lobby where you have to go the splitscreen and turn on the unlocks. If so could you quote me and tell me on how to do so <3 It would be much appreciated, because the only button I have gotten to work so far is the select button.

After being informed and re-assured by xRAZBAZx, the only buttons that stick for infections are ....
; bind button_back
&
; bind button_start
